Best container optimized linux distribution. Especially that the OS can be configured via an API with a config.yaml in the same declarative way you would update or configure any K8s resource. The reduced attack surface by slimming down the OS is just a side benefit for me.
I've been using Talos OS in my production clusters at work and in my home lab on bare metal as well as virtualized with great success.
It also has also a very good documentation with a lot pf examples for often needed configurations. They even provide a guide on how to setup Kubevirt on Talos OS.
I’ve been running Talos Linux for several months now, and it’s unlike any other distribution I’ve used. As a platform engineer working heavily with Kubernetes, I love how it redefines what “immutable” means for a cluster OS. No SSH, no package manager, no mutable state—everything is API-driven and declarative. It’s minimal, secure by design, and incredibly consistent across nodes.
The integration with Kubernetes is flawless—upgrades, node provisioning, and configuration management feel effortless. I used to dread OS drift and patching chaos; Talos made all of that disappear. It’s not a daily-driver distro, but for production-grade clusters or homelabs, it’s an absolute dream.
Talos Linux is one of those rare projects that redefines how we think about operating systems for Kubernetes clusters. It’s not just a stripped-down Linux distribution; it’s an OS engineered specifically for cloud native infrastructure. Everything about Talos feels intentional. It’s immutable, API-driven, and purpose-built for automation and GitOps workflows. For anyone serious about consistency, security, and reproducibility, this system is a breath of fresh air.
One of its biggest strengths is how it eliminates the concept of SSH-based management. Instead, everything is controlled via an API or through the talosctl CLI, which enforces declarative operations. This approach not only enhances security by reducing the attack surface, but also aligns perfectly with infrastructure-as-code practices. Every change can be version-controlled, peer-reviewed, and applied consistently across clusters, which fits beautifully into GitOps pipelines.
The minimal footprint is another major win. Talos runs with an incredibly small attack surface and minimal user space, reducing patching overhead and potential vulnerabilities. It’s like the OS equivalent of Kubernetes itself: everything that’s not essential is simply removed. The result is a platform that feels rock solid, lightweight, and built to scale with confidence.
Upgrades are smooth and transactional. Rollbacks are clean. Boot-time configuration is entirely declarative. Combine that with its containerd integration and native support for kubeadm, and you get an elegant, self-healing foundation for modern Kubernetes clusters.
Talos Linux delivers on the dream of “cattle, not pets” at the OS level. It’s reliable, secure, and automation-friendly. For DevOps engineers who crave simplicity and control without compromise, Talos isn’t just another distro—it’s the future of cloud native operating systems.
Best kubernetes distro for me
Easy to maintain and upgrade.
Lightweight, immutable and declarated settings via powerfull api.
Multiple choice for deployment, bare metal, cloud... even raspberrypi
A tools has been created by the team to deploy and maintain clusters, it's called Omnii
Check it out, you would not regret it.
It's my first choice when i wanna deploy kubernetes in 2025.
The documentation as well is crystal clear. Talos team did a excellent work
Thank you for this masterpiece of engineering.
The easiest and most secure way to run Kubernetes hands down.
The API is a game changer for people who are used to managing servers with configuration management and SSH.
1.11 added user volumes to make it easy to partition disks for Kubernetes workloads to use. The upgrade path with a single config file to upgrade Talos and Kubernetes makes it super easy to never have to worry about Kubernetes and Linux again.
This version works great with devices with UEFI boot system and be careful if you're upgrading from older GRUB based boot menus.
Best container optimized linux distribution. Especially that the OS can be configured via an API with a config.yaml in the same declarative way you would update or configure any K8s resource. The reduced attack surface by slimming down the OS is just a side benefit for me.
I've been using Talos OS in my production clusters at work and in my home lab on bare metal as well as virtualized with great success.
It also has also a very good documentation with a lot pf examples for often needed configurations. They even provide a guide on how to setup Kubevirt on Talos OS.
I’ve been running Talos Linux for several months now, and it’s unlike any other distribution I’ve used. As a platform engineer working heavily with Kubernetes, I love how it redefines what “immutable” means for a cluster OS. No SSH, no package manager, no mutable state—everything is API-driven and declarative. It’s minimal, secure by design, and incredibly consistent across nodes.
The integration with Kubernetes is flawless—upgrades, node provisioning, and configuration management feel effortless. I used to dread OS drift and patching chaos; Talos made all of that disappear. It’s not a daily-driver distro, but for production-grade clusters or homelabs, it’s an absolute dream.
The easiest and most secure way to run Kubernetes hands down.
The API is a game changer for people who are used to managing servers with configuration management and SSH.
1.11 added user volumes to make it easy to partition disks for Kubernetes workloads to use. The upgrade path with a single config file to upgrade Talos and Kubernetes makes it super easy to never have to worry about Kubernetes and Linux again.
This version works great with devices with UEFI boot system and be careful if you're upgrading from older GRUB based boot menus.
Best kubernetes distro for me
Easy to maintain and upgrade.
Lightweight, immutable and declarated settings via powerfull api.
Multiple choice for deployment, bare metal, cloud... even raspberrypi
A tools has been created by the team to deploy and maintain clusters, it's called Omnii
Check it out, you would not regret it.
It's my first choice when i wanna deploy kubernetes in 2025.
The documentation as well is crystal clear. Talos team did a excellent work
Thank you for this masterpiece of engineering.
Talos Linux is one of those rare projects that redefines how we think about operating systems for Kubernetes clusters. It’s not just a stripped-down Linux distribution; it’s an OS engineered specifically for cloud native infrastructure. Everything about Talos feels intentional. It’s immutable, API-driven, and purpose-built for automation and GitOps workflows. For anyone serious about consistency, security, and reproducibility, this system is a breath of fresh air.
One of its biggest strengths is how it eliminates the concept of SSH-based management. Instead, everything is controlled via an API or through the talosctl CLI, which enforces declarative operations. This approach not only enhances security by reducing the attack surface, but also aligns perfectly with infrastructure-as-code practices. Every change can be version-controlled, peer-reviewed, and applied consistently across clusters, which fits beautifully into GitOps pipelines.
The minimal footprint is another major win. Talos runs with an incredibly small attack surface and minimal user space, reducing patching overhead and potential vulnerabilities. It’s like the OS equivalent of Kubernetes itself: everything that’s not essential is simply removed. The result is a platform that feels rock solid, lightweight, and built to scale with confidence.
Upgrades are smooth and transactional. Rollbacks are clean. Boot-time configuration is entirely declarative. Combine that with its containerd integration and native support for kubeadm, and you get an elegant, self-healing foundation for modern Kubernetes clusters.
Talos Linux delivers on the dream of “cattle, not pets” at the OS level. It’s reliable, secure, and automation-friendly. For DevOps engineers who crave simplicity and control without compromise, Talos isn’t just another distro—it’s the future of cloud native operating systems.
TUXEDO
TUXEDO Computers - Linux Hardware in a tailor made suite Choose from a wide range of laptops and PCs in various sizes and shapes at TUXEDOComputers.com. Every machine comes pre-installed and ready-to-run with Linux. Full 24 months of warranty and lifetime support included!
Learn more about our full service package and all benefits from buying at TUXEDO.
Advertisement
Star Labs
Star Labs - Laptops built for Linux.
View our range including the highly anticipated StarFighter. Available with coreboot open-source firmware and a choice of Ubuntu, elementary, Manjaro and more. Visit Star Labs for information, to buy and get support.